Issue:
Troubleshoot for an EEF1 fault on a Process Drive
Product Line:
Altivar 6xx and 9xx Process Drives
Environment:
All
Cause:
An error of the internal memory of the control block has been detected.
Resolution:
Verify the environment (electromagnetic compatibility).
This detected error requires a power reset. Remove line voltage until the display goes all the way out. Then reapply line voltage.
If cycling line voltage doesn't clear the fault, save your programming in the keypad or SoMove, and perform a factory reset.
After factory reset cycle line voltage again.
If the fault remains, drive replacement is required.
